3 Maintenance

3.1 Introduction

Structure of this chapter
This chapter describes all the maintenance activities recommended for the IRB
2600/IRB 2600 ID.
It is based on the maintenance schedule found at the beginning of the chapter.
The schedule contains information about required maintenance activities including
intervals, and refers to procedures for the activities.
Each procedure contains all the information required to perform the activity,
including required tools and materials.
The procedures are gathered in different sections and divided according to the
maintenance activity.

Note
If the IRB 2600/IRB 2600 ID is connected to power, always make sure that the
IRB 2600/IRB 2600 ID is connected to protective earth before starting any
maintenance work.
